Cybersecurity researchers have shared details of a malware campaign targeting Ethereum, XRP, and Solana. The attack mainly targets Atomic and Exodus wallet users through compromised node package manager (NPM) packages. It then redirects transactions to attacker-controlled addresses without the wallet…
